Order Management Associate information

What are some common challenges faced by order management associates, and how can they be addressed?

Order Management Associates often encounter challenges such as managing high volumes of orders, resolving discrepancies between purchase orders and inventory, and ensuring timely communication with customers and internal teams. Staying organized, being detail-oriented, and utilizing order management software efficiently can help address these challenges. Building strong relationships with colleagues in sales, logistics, and customer service also supports smoother operations and faster problem resolution.

What does an order management associate do?

An Order Management Associate is responsible for processing and managing customer orders from initiation to delivery. They ensure orders are accurately entered into the system, coordinate with various departments like sales, logistics, and customer service, and resolve any issues that arise during the order fulfillment process. Their goal is to ensure timely delivery and customer satisfaction while maintaining accurate records and compliance with company policies.

Is order management a good career?

Order management is a viable career that involves coordinating and processing customer orders, often requiring skills in communication, organization, and familiarity with enterprise resource planning (ERP) systems. It offers opportunities for advancement into supervisory or specialized roles and is commonly found in industries like retail, manufacturing, and logistics. The role typically involves standard office hours and may require attention to detail and problem-solving skills.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an order management associate,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Order Management Associate, you need strong organizational skills, attention to detail, and knowledge of order processing and supply chain concepts, often supported by a relevant degree or experience in logistics or business. Familiarity with order management systems (OMS), enterprise resource planning (ERP) software like SAP or Oracle, and proficiency in Microsoft Excel are commonly required. Excellent communication, problem-solving abilities, and the capacity to multitask help you excel in customer interactions and cross-functional coordination. These skills ensure accurate and timely order fulfillment, customer satisfaction, and efficient workflow within the organization.

Data Integrity Associate
Wayne State University is searching for an experienced Data Integrity Associate at its Detroit campus location.
Wayne State is a premier, public, urban research university located in the heart of Detroit, Michigan where students from all backgrounds are offered a rich, high-quality education. Our deep-rooted commitment to excellence, collaboration, integrity, diversity and inclusion creates exceptional educational opportunities which prepare students for success in a global society.
Essential functions (job duties):
Job Purpose
The Data Integrity Associate is responsible to analyze, monitor and maintain the accuracy, integrity and quality of the alumni, donor and gift records in the administrative database of record for the Division of Development and Alumni Affairs. Identify and remedy data integrity issues and errors. Maintain a systematic approach to keeping the records accurate and contribute to data enhancement projects. Work with other units in the division to coordinate data maintenance efforts. This position reports to the Associate Director, Data Integrity.
Essential Functions
(Essential functions are the primary duties/major job responsibilities that an employee must be able to perform, with or without reasonable accommodation. The essential functions are listed in order of importance.)
Compile and analyze data extracted from the division's administrative database(s) and Operational Data Store (ODS) to maintain data integrity, facilitate data hygiene projects and produce accurate reports. 25%
Analyze data for integrity noncompliance based on university and division business rules, user input and best practices. Identify and correct structural and semantic data errors. 25%
Maintain alumni, donor and gift records as directed, including deletions, additions and modifications. Process data update requests from staff, donors, alumni and friends. Assist the Manager, Data Integrity in evaluating the availability, operational need, and return on investment in the purchasing and uploading of new data as well as the outsourcing of various data cleansing projects. 10%
Assist in data repository conversions, system adjustments, and strategies. Prepare and process data specifications for administrative database modules, prepare test plans, execute validation and perform other project-related work. 10%
Execute protocols for routine updates of biographical data in the division's administrative database(s), including call center and NCOA updates. Establish a protocol to track update requests and monitor completions. Monitor and report on the progress of all ongoing data integrity projects. 10%
Upload modified records collected from external sources into the division's administrative database(s). 5%
Code large groups of alumni, donors and prospects to support the university's alumni engagement, fundraising, and donor stewardship activities. Research third party vendors and data enhancement services, as requested. 5%
Represent the division on various data committees and user groups related to data integrity. 5%
Perform other related duties as assigned. 5%
